The California Highway Patrol is investigating reports of a shooting near the Bay Bridge toll plaza that has closed several lanes on eastbound Interstate 80 Tuesday evening.
SKY7 was over the scene which showed CHP officers walking on the freeway looking for evidence related to that possible shooting.
